In this lesson, we’re going to go over the E in WEIRDOS, which stands for Emotions & Feelings.

Simply so What does the I in weirdos stand for? The WEIRDO Method

WEIRDO stands for Wishes, Emotions, Impersonal expressions, Recommendations, Doubt/Denial and Ojalá (Hopefully).

Is Creo que subjunctive?

“Creo que” can be used to express that maybe something is happening, but you’re not completely sure. In this case, use either the conditional or the subjunctive (depending on the situation). “No creo que” expresses doubt. Use subjunctive.

Does quiero que trigger subjunctive? Yes, all the time. When you want someone to do something, querer is followed by the subjunctive. Quiero que me digas la verdad. … Sure, it’s one of the most common verbs to be followed by the subjunctive.

What is subjunctive mood Spanish?

The Spanish subjunctive mood (“el subjuntivo”) is used with impersonal expressions and expressions of opinions, emotions or points of view. It’s also used for expressing denial, disagreement or volition as well as for describing situations that are doubtful or unlikely.

What happens to car gar ZAR verbs? Remember that when you conjugate verbs ending in -car, -zar, and -gar in the preterite tense, the spelling of the verb changes as follows in the yo form: –car the c changes to qu before adding the é -zar the z changes to c before adding the é -gar the g changes to gu before adding the é

Is ella no cree que subjunctive?

Generally, the indicative is used with creer que or pensar que, while the subjunctive is used with no creer que or no pensar que.

What are Spanish weirdo verbs? Many of the words and phrases that trigger the subjunctive fit into the acronym WEIRDO, which stands for: Wishes, Emotions, Impersonal expressions, Recommendations, Doubt/Denial, and Ojalá. Is Es probable que subjunctive? Es improbable or Es probable both leave room for chance, hence the need for the subjunctive in Spanish. Do not let the translation throw you off (It’s probable or improbable).

Does es una lastima que use subjunctive?

Examples of the subjunctive being used in expressing personal reactions: Es (una) lástima que (It’s a shame that): ¡Es una lástima que no estés conmigo! (It’s a shame that you aren’t with me!)

What does car turn into in Spanish? There are several Spanish verbs that undergo a spelling change in certain preterite tense conjugations.

Group 1: -car, -gar, and -zar Verbs.

Verb Type Change Example
-car c changes to qu bus qu é
-gar g changes to gu cargué
-zar z changes to c almorcé
